Here are some of the crucial ways in which you can focus on emotional intelligence as a leader right now.

When it concerns leading in any kind of industry, there is no denying the value of emotional intelligence. This covers a wide variety of areas, each of which will make sure that you sustain a positive working environment within business. Leaders who have high emotional intelligence have the ability to very carefully handle their own emotions along with those of the people around them, fostering a more productive approach to working. One of the key ways in which you can achieve this is through showing that you possess self-awareness. This means that you make the effort to check in with yourself on a regular basis, understanding what effects your own feelings, along with understanding your own strengths and weak points along the way. Having these leadership soft skills will allow you to comprehend yourself in the most impactful manner, thus allowing you to use your skillset to be the very best leader possible. If you are curious about how to improve EQ in business today, one of the very best pointers would be to work on your ability to understand the perspectives of others. Many individuals might have the misconception that a leader ought to always know everything and make all of the choices, however in reality it can be so important to take other people's opinions and feedback on board. Showing emotional intelligence will consist of asking people why they think the way they do, comprehending what inspires them and talking with them in the most respectful way at all times. Having these capabilities will enable you to foster a highly positive working environment where people feel respected and able to come to you whenever they might require assistance or when check here they have new ideas to bring to the table. Upon examining the examples of emotional intelligence in leadership, it is clear to see that one of the most crucial aspects would be celebrating individuals around you. When you make the effort to acknowledge when good work is being done, those on your team are going to feel appreciated and therefore more willing to continue with this work ethic. Additionally, you ought to take the steps to understand people's needs and goals so that you can ensure that you are supporting them with this and giving them the praise that they need to keep working towards them.
